1. 5 Steps to Proper Beach Etiquette: Ensuring a Pleasant Experience

When visiting the beach, it is important to follow proper etiquette to ensure a pleasant experience for everyone. By adhering to these guidelines, you can create a harmonious environment and make the most of your time by the ocean.

1. Respect the Space

Be mindful of the personal space of others and avoid crowding. Set up your belongings at a reasonable distance from others to allow for privacy and comfort.

2. Clean up After Yourself

Leave the beach as clean as you found it by disposing of your trash properly. Bring a bag for your garbage and be sure to pick up any litter you see.

3. Follow Noise Guidelines

Keep noise levels to a minimum to avoid disturbing others. Use headphones when listening to music and refrain from shouting or playing loud games.

4. Observe Beach Safety Rules

Stay within designated swimming areas, obey lifeguard instructions, and be aware of any warning flags. Follow all safety guidelines to ensure a safe and enjoyable beach visit.

5. Be Mindful of Wildlife

Respect the natural habitat of beach wildlife by not disturbing or feeding them. Keep a safe distance and observe from afar to avoid causing harm.

2. 5 Productive Tips for Behaving Appropriately at the Beach

One of the key aspects of a pleasant beach experience is behaving appropriately. To ensure you make the most of your time at the beach, here are five productive tips to follow:

1. Respect the Space

When at the beach, it’s important to respect the personal space of others. Avoid setting up your belongings too close to others and be mindful of your noise level.

2. Keep it Clean

Maintaining cleanliness is crucial for a positive beach environment. Dispose of your trash properly, and if you see any litter, pick it up. Leave the beach as pristine as you found it.

3. Follow the Rules

Be aware of any rules or regulations specific to the beach you’re visiting. This includes restrictions on alcohol, pets, and bonfires. By obeying these rules, you contribute to a safe and enjoyable atmosphere.

4. Be Mindful of Wildlife

Respect the natural habitat of the beach by avoiding disturbing or feeding wildlife. Keep a safe distance from any nesting areas and refrain from touching or removing any marine life.

5. Practice Sun Safety

Protect yourself and others from the harmful effects of the sun by wearing sunscreen, seeking shade, and staying hydrated. Remember, sunburns can quickly ruin a day at the beach.

By following these productive tips, you can ensure a respectful and enjoyable beach experience for yourself and others.
